James "Jim" Rossong
September 24, 1956 - May 12, 2017

It is with very heavy hearts that the family of James “Jim” Douglas Rossong announce his passing on May 12, 2017. He was 60 years old. He is survived by his wife Diane and beloved son, James Jordan “JJ”; sisters, Dorothy of Thornhill, ON and Mary of Calgary, AB; brother, John of Amherst, NS; nephews, Billie-Joe of Calgary, AB and Alex of Amherst, NS; nieces, Jessica and Emily of Amherst, NS; half-brothers, Albert of Moncton, NB and Morris of Springhill, NS. He was predeceased by his mother Charlotte Springhill, NS, father James of Canso, NS and baby sister, Donna Marie. James Douglas Rossong, also known by his family as “Jim”, “Jimmy” and “Rags”. He was a man of many nicknames, with his wife Diane calling him “Soup” or “Soupy” and his son, JJ calling him “Daddy”. He was a very proud and loving father and husband. His sense of humor would light up a room and those around him would always enjoy sharing a good laugh. Jim had an undying love for fishing and would never miss an opportunity to get out to the lake. Although gone too soon, we are forever grateful to Alcoholics Anonymous for the 20 plus years we were given with him. Truly a miracle.
